How Photo Recover Applications Function
Photo recover applications are designed to locate deleted images and restore them to accessible storage. These applications operate by scanning internal memory, external memory cards, and cloud storage to detect files that have been marked as deleted. Most modern operating systems, including Android and iOS, do not immediately erase deleted files. Instead, the space occupied by deleted files is marked as available, which allows recovery applications to retrieve these files before they are overwritten.
The App’s recovery process generally involves three stages: scanning, previewing, and restoration. During the scanning phase, the application searches storage sectors for residual data. Once potential files are located, the preview phase allows users to verify that the files are intact and suitable for recovery. The final restoration stage transfers the recovered images to a secure location, either on the device itself or on external storage.

Leading Photo Recovery Applications for Android Devices
Android users have access to a wide variety of photo recovery applications. These applications are capable of restoring deleted images from internal storage, external memory cards, and cloud backups. Some of the most reliable options are:
DiskDigger Photo Recovery
DiskDigger Photo Recovery is one of the most popular applications for Android. It enables users to recover deleted photos efficiently and supports formats including JPEG, PNG, and RAW files. DiskDigger offers both a simple scan and a deep scan, the latter providing a more thorough search for older or fragmented images.
Advantages:
- User-friendly interface suitable for beginners
- Supports multiple image formats
- Allows cloud backup storage for recovered photos
Limitations:
- Deep scan requires root access for advanced recovery
- The free version provides limited functionality

PhotoRec Application
PhotoRec is a free, open-source tool compatible with Windows, Mac, and Linux. It provides deep scanning to recover a broad range of file types. Although it is command-line-based, advanced users can recover extensive data effectively.
Advantages:
- Free and open-source
- Cross-platform compatibility
- Supports deep scanning for thorough recovery
Limitations:
- The command-line interface may be challenging for beginners
- Requires technical knowledge for optimal results

Common Causes of Photo Loss
Understanding why photos are deleted helps prevent future data loss. Common reasons include:
- Accidental Deletion
Users often remove images unintentionally during device management or app usage. - Software or System Errors
Device crashes, glitches, or application errors may result in photo loss. - Storage Formatting
Formatting internal storage or memory cards deletes all files. - Malware or Virus Attacks
Malicious software can corrupt or erase images. - Physical Device Damage
Hardware failure, water damage, or broken memory cards can make images inaccessible.

Best Practices for Successful Photo Recovery
To maximize recovery success, users should follow established best practices:
- Immediate Action
Attempt recovery as soon as possible after accidental deletion. - Avoid Writing New Data
Do not add new files or applications until recovery is complete. - Choose Reliable Applications
Use applications with proven performance and positive user reviews. - Maintain Regular Backups
Employ cloud services such as Google Photos and iCloud to prevent permanent data loss. - Verify File Format Support
Ensure the recovery application supports the specific image formats being restored.

Frequently Asked Questions About Photo Recover Applications
Can photos be recovered after weeks of deletion?
Recovery is most effective immediately. Over time, data may be overwritten, reducing recovery chances.
Is rooting or jailbreaking required for photo recovery?
Some applications provide recovery without rooting or jailbreaking. Tools like Tenorshare UltData enable secure recovery without modifying device security.
Do cloud backups make recovery unnecessary?
Cloud backups provide a supplementary safety net, but local recovery applications are still valuable for recently deleted images.
Can formatted memory cards be recovered?
Yes, recovery is possible if new data has not been written over the formatted storage.
Is recovery guaranteed?
No method guarantees complete recovery. Early action and reliable software maximize the likelihood of successful restoration.
